TYUMEN, September 10 – RIA Novosti. Preliminarily, there were no casualties in the fire in seven residential buildings on the Salairsky tract in Tyumen, reports the main department of the Ministry of Emergency Situations for the Tyumen region.
“According to preliminary information, there were no casualties. Currently, more than 20 people and seven pieces of equipment are involved in extinguishing the fire,” the statement says.
